Concrete foundation leveling services involve assessing and correcting uneven or sinking concrete slabs that support structures such as driveways, patios, walkways, or basement floors. The process typically includes identifying areas of settlement or cracking, then using specialized techniques to lift and stabilize the affected concrete. This may involve the use of polyurethane foam injections, mudjacking, or other methods designed to restore the slab’s original position and ensure a level, stable surface. The goal is to improve the structural integrity and appearance of the concrete while preventing further damage or shifting.

These services address common problems associated with uneven foundations, including cracked or cracked-looking concrete, pooling water, trip hazards, and further structural deterioration. Over time, soil movement, moisture fluctuations, or poor initial installation can cause concrete slabs to settle unevenly. Leveling helps mitigate these issues by evenly distributing the weight of the structure and preventing additional cracking or shifting. Properly leveled concrete also enhances safety and functionality, especially in areas with high foot traffic or vehicle use.

Cost Range for Concrete Foundation Leveling - The typical cost for foundation leveling services can vary widely, often falling between $2,000 and $7,000 depending on the extent of the work and foundation size. Smaller repairs may cost around $1,500, while larger projects could reach $10,000 or more.

Factors Influencing Costs - The total expense depends on factors such as foundation type, soil conditions, and the severity of settling. For example, minor adjustments might be priced at approximately $2,500, whereas extensive leveling could be closer to $8,000.

Average Pricing in Local Areas - In Jefferson County, WV and nearby regions, homeowners typically see costs range from $3,000 to $6,000 for standard foundation leveling services. Larger or more complex projects may be priced higher based on specific needs.

Additional Cost Considerations - Extra services like pier installation or foundation crack repair can add to the overall cost, potentially increasing the total by a few thousand dollars.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on individual foundation conditions.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es concrete slabs to settle or sink? Concrete slabs can settle due to soil erosion, moisture changes, or poor initial compaction, leading to uneven surfaces.

How do professionals level uneven concrete slabs? Experts typically use slab jacking or mudjacking techniques to lift and stabilize the concrete.

Is concrete leveling a permanent solution? When properly performed, concrete leveling can provide a long-lasting correction, though underlying soil issues may need to be addressed.

What are the signs that a concrete slab needs leveling? Visible cracks, uneven surfaces, and pooling water are common indicators that a slab may require leveling services.
